20120045024 | METHODS AND APPARATUS FOR ITERATIVE DECODING IN MULTIPLE-INPUT-MULTIPLE-OUTPUT (MIMO) COMMUNICATION SYSTEMS - Methods and apparatus for receiving, processing, and decoding MIMO transmissions in communications systems are described. A non-Gaussian approximation method for simplifying processing complexity where summations are used is described. Use of a priori information to facilitate determination of log likelihood ratios (LLRs) in receivers using iterative decoders is further described. A Gaussian or non-Gaussian approximation method using a priori information may be used to determine a K-best list of values for summation to generate an LLR is also described. | 02-23-2012 |

20150082963 | SINTERED COMPOSITE BODY COMPRISING CEMENTED CARBIDE AND CBN GRAINS - A sintered composite body of cemented carbide and cBN grains, wherein the cBN grains are dispersed in a cemented carbide matrix. The body further includes a cBN depleted zone extending 50-400 μm from the surface of the body towards the core thereof. The mean cBN grain size outside the depleted zone is 1-20 μm and the cBN content outside the depleted zone is 0.3-4 wt %. | 03-26-2015 |

20100039564 | ANALYSING VIDEO MATERIAL - Video material is dividing into temporal segments. Each segment is examined to determine whether the soundtrack of the segment contains speech sufficient for analysis and if so, metadata are generated based on analysis of the speech. If not, the segment is analysed by comparing frames thereof with those of stored segments that already have metadata assigned to them. One then assigns to the segment under consideration stored metadata associated with one or more stored segments that are similar. | 02-18-2010 |

20080235203 | Information Retrieval - A method and apparatus are provided for accessing a relevant information resource in response to a user query. An ontology is provided, defining relationships between a plurality of predefined concepts, and between each of the predefined concepts and one or more predefined context phrases. On receipt of a user query, portions of the received query are compared with the context phrases to identify one or more matching phrases and hence, from the predefined relationships with concepts in the ontology, one or more relevant concepts. Concepts identified in respect of the received user query are used to identify a relevant action using predefined relationships between concepts in the ontology and predefined actions, wherein an action comprises providing access to an information resource. | 09-25-2008 |

20100044310 | METHOD, EQUIPMENT AND SPECIFIC DRAWER FOR MEMBRANE SEPARATION UTILIZING CONCENTRATION POLARIZATION - The present invention relates to a membrane separation method and a relevant equipment, in particular to a method and an equipment for membrane separation utilizing concentration polarization during membrane filtration process, especially, to a concentration process and equipment and a drawer special for drawing a concentration polarization layer. The direct removal of the concentration polarization layer from membrane surface not only decreases the adverse influence of concentration polarization on membrane separation but also obtains concentrated retention components, thereby significantly improving the ability to maintain membrane flux, solving the twinborn problems concerning concentration polarization and membrane fouling during the membrane separation process, and achieving a high-efficiency concentration for retention components. The method and equipment of the present invention can be widely applied in various membrane techniques, in particular in a membrane separation process for concentrating biomacromolecule and organic micromolecule products such as sugars, organic acids and polypeptides etc. | 02-25-2010 |
